Ускорение сайта с использованием gzip и даты истечения срока давности
Я недавно развернул сайт http://boardlite.com/. Один из веб-сайтов тестеров http://www.gidnetwork.com/tools/gzip-test.php предполагает, что gzip не включен для моего сайта. YSlow дает оценку A для Gzip, но не упоминает, что gzip включен.
Как мне убедиться, что на сайте правильно реализован Gzip. I am also going to enable far-future expiry dates for static media. I would like to know if there are any best practices for setting the expiry date.
Static media on the site is served by nginx server while the site itself runs on top of apache, just in case if this information is required.
2 ответа
Похоже, Gzip включен на вашем сервере. Вы можете узнать, проверив заголовки ответа HTTP для "Content-Encoding: gzip".
Я не могу придумать какие-либо "лучшие практики" для будущих дат истечения срока действия - кроме как убедиться, что они не в прошлом;)
Есть много других способов оптимизации вашего веб-сайта. Спрайтинг ваших фоновых изображений CSS и использование сети доставки контента для статического контента - вот некоторые из них.
Эндрю
Я бы посоветовал не заходить слишком далеко в будущее, иначе вы сделаете модернизацию сайта настоящим кошмаром. Я полагаю, что недели должно быть достаточно, так как после этого вы все равно будете отправлять только 302 ответа, а не всю картинку.